INGREDIENTS: COCONUT OIL, SHEA BUTTER, CASTOR SEED OIL, SUNFLOWER SEED OIL (WITH ARNICA FLOWER EXTRACT), CETEARYL ALCOHOL, CARNAUBA WAX, CANDELILLA WAX, LAVENDER OIL. GERANIUM OIL, VITAMIN-E, AND ALOE VERA LEAF EXTRACT.
Instructions; Apply thin layer topically to clean affected area. Can massage it in or let it absorb and air dry. Don’t exceed 4 uses, with 3-4 hours in between each use. Never apply to an open wound!!
**For adults and children age 2 and over.
**Do not tightly wrap or bandage the treated area. Do not apply heat or ice to the treated area immediately before or after use.
**Extra instructions for botox/lip filler/procedure;
Before: Apply arnica to the injection sites 1–3 days prior to your appointment to prep the skin.
After: Continue applying it topically 2–3 times daily for 3–5 days post-procedure to speed up the healing of any bruises. Be gentle when applying to injection/botox areas.. Avoid rubbing or massaging procedure areas in excess for atleast 24 hours after treatment.
